Starting with history, a visit to the iconic California State Capitol Building is a must. This magnificent structure not only serves as the political hub of the state but also offers an opportunity to learn about California’s rich history. Take a guided tour to explore the stunning architecture, admire the beautiful gardens, and indulge in the captivating exhibits housed within the building.

Just a stone’s throw away from the Capitol is the Old Sacramento Historic District. Step back in time as you wander through the cobbled streets of this well-preserved 19th-century town. Explore the numerous museums, including the California State Railroad Museum, which give an insight into the city’s storied past. Hop aboard an authentic steam locomotive and experience the thrill of the golden era of rail travel.

For art enthusiasts, a visit to the Crocker Art Museum is a must. Established in 1885, it is the oldest art museum in the West. Marvel at the impressive collection of California art, European masterpieces, and fascinating international pieces. The stunning architecture of the museum itself is a work of art. Enjoy a leisurely stroll through the adjacent Crocker Park, a peaceful oasis in the heart of the city.

Nature enthusiasts will find solace in the many outdoor treasures Sacramento has to offer. The American River Parkway, a scenic 32-mile stretch of protected land, provides ample opportunities for hiking, biking, and picnicking along the river’s pristine shores. Escape the hustle and bustle of the city and reconnect with nature in this serene oasis.
